The Institute of Gerontology is housed in the Slaughter Building. The building is located at the corner of Hancock and College Avenues in downtown Athens. The Institute of Gerontology building comprises approximately 7,800 square feet and is divided into a first floor and basement level layout.

The first floor consists of offices, supply and copy rooms, as well as a 662 square foot classroom and conference room. The classroom and conference room also contain our paper and digital reference library, as well as a state of the art computer and DVD/VHS projection system. The sound system in the conference room includes an integrated mixer, power amplifier and a JBL control speaker system. The basement level consists of the Older Adult Physical Performance Laboratory, offices, storage space, image library, and a 553 square foot computer support area.
